Output 70dd89f50ea34bc5127247f60998aaff349a627a618c876f2fd5db4822c2b973:1

value
27616922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ed1e5fdabd65ca5e51968c7b9ecf789b928c5d1e OP_EQUAL
address
3PJnTTdtnHagXafwHmjJ4JETPcu1qK5kV2
transaction
70dd89f50ea34bc5127247f60998aaff349a627a618c876f2fd5db4822c2b973
spent
true